The Western Canada Farm Progress Show is the place to see the latest advancements in farming technology. Visitors at the Show can easily get a preview of what tools are becoming available to make their jobs easier.

The New Inventions Showcase is a focal point of the Western Farm Progress Show every year. This year will most likely feature about 40 new products that will be available from over a dozen companies for the first time. They could range from such past inventions as wheel lugs for antique tractors to infrared and remote control technology. Many of the products will be designed to reduce environmental impact, such as drift reducing nozzles for sprayers, a tool for reclaiming and rejuvenating pasture or technology that allows old air seeder tanks to be transformed into portable watering systems for livestock. Others could make tough jobs easier, such as a gate that lifts vertically from even heavy snow by remote control, and machines that move augers, barrels and other heavy items. And some could just make life a little easier, such as a metric/imperial converter, an automatic corral gate closer and a handheld scoop that doubles as a scale.

 The New Inventions Showcase will be located in Co-operators Center, Arena #3.
